AIQ Global is advancing precision oncology through AI-driven software that helps clinicians better understand how late-stage cancer patients are responding to treatment. Its FDA-cleared TRAQinform IQ platform delivers lesion-level imaging analytics designed to support more informed treatment decisions and improve patient outcomes. This is the second investment by NYA Members in the past year. Rob Hedlund and Tom Hirschfeld managed the follow-on round with AIQ Global.
Bounce Imaging offers a suite of tactical, 360-degree camera systems used by over 450 state and local law enforcement agencies and first responders, the FBI, U.S. Marshals and elite teams within the Department of Defense. The company was originally founded at the Harvard Innovation Laboratory and MIT. This new deal for NYA was led by Glen Lewy and Anne Friberg.
Caretech Human has developed AI-powered, contactless health monitoring technology designed to transform everyday routines into actionable healthcare insights. The Cornell-based startup’s toilet-integrated platform helps passively monitor key urological health indicators, supporting earlier detection and more personalized patient care. Recently, the company advanced clinical trials with major healthcare partners. Patrick Lambert and Mauri Rosenthal helped lead the deal for NYA Members.
Counterdrone has created the first universal multi-drone docking station that provides superior wind and weather resistance, while requiring a minimal amount of space. Drone docking stations are becoming a staple of aerial infrastructure, and Counterdrone stations are easily upgradeable and adaptable to new drones as organizations upgrade their drone fleet. Mike Gibbons and Anne Friberg led the new investment for NYA Members.

ATRAVERSE
Johnson & Johnson recently announced it has entered into a definitive agreement to acquire Atraverse Medical. Atraverse's Hotwire product is the first left-heart access system with impedance-guided technology and a mechanism to halt energy delivery to minimize unnecessary RF exposure in the left atrium. TECHCRUNCH
THE 12-MONTH WINDOW
AI investor Elad Gil identifies the 12-month exit window in a recent interivew. For most companies, Gil says, there is roughly a 12-month period where the business is at its peak value, “and then it crashes out.” To catch that window, Gil offered a practical suggestion: pre-schedule a board meeting once or twice a year specifically to discuss exits. If it is a standing calendar item, it drains the emotion out of the equation.
